Dim m_DragMode As Boolean
Dim m_DragX As Single
Dim m_DragY As Single
Private Sub Picture1_MouseDown(Button As Integer, Shift As Integer, X As Single, Y As Single)
m_DragMode = True
m_DragX = X
m_DragY = Y
End Sub
Private Sub Picture1_MouseMove(Button As Integer, Shift As Integer, X As Single, Y As Single)
If Me.WindowState = vbMaximized Or Me.WindowState = vbMinimized Then Exit Sub
If m_DragMode Then
Me.Move Me.Left + X - m_DragX, Me.Top + Y - m_DragY
End If
End Sub
Private Sub Picture1_MouseUp(Button As Integer, Shift As Integer, X As Single, Y As Single)
m_DragMode = False
End Sub
'Vc pode usar a rotina para um controle ou para o Proprio Form